diff --git a/test/test_node.rb b/test/test_node.rb index 9d1acb0..0e83e4c 100755 --- a/test/test_node.rb +++ b/test/test_node.rb @@ -189,7 +189,7 @@ def test_sim_time end clock_pub.publish(time_msg) - sleep 0.5 + sleep 1.0 sim_current = ROS::Time.now assert_equal(time_msg.clock, sim_current) diff --git a/test/test_rate.rb b/test/test_rate.rb index edddfe5..f9a8676 100755 --- a/test/test_rate.rb +++ b/test/test_rate.rb @@ -5,6 +5,8 @@ class TestRate_rate < Test::Unit::TestCase def test_sleep + param = ROS::ParameterManager.new(ENV['ROS_MASTER_URI'], '/use_sim_time', {}) + param.set_param('/use_sim_time', false) r = ROS::Rate.new(10) (1..10).each do |i| start = ::Time.now